Q: Is 106,150,050 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 106,150,050 is a composite number.

Why is 106,150,050 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 106,150,050 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 9 10 15 18 25 30 45 50 75 90 150 225 450 235,889 471,778 707,667 1,179,445 1,415,334 2,123,001 2,358,890 3,538,335 4,246,002 5,897,225 7,076,670 10,615,005 11,794,450 17,691,675 21,230,010 35,383,350 53,075,025 and 106,150,050, with no remainder.

Since 106,150,050 cannot be divided by just 1 and 106,150,050, it is a composite number.
